Ingredients
1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
3 ½ te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on salt
1 tablespoon white sugar
1 ¼ cups milk
1 egg
3 tablespoons butter, melted
Step 1
In a large bowl, sift together the flour, baking sugar, salt, and powder. Create a nicely in the middle and put in the dairy, egg and melted butter; blend until smooth.
Step 2
Heat a lightly oiled griddle or perhaps frying pan over medium high temperature. Pour or perhaps harvest the batter onto the griddle, using around 1/4 cup for every pancake. Brown on both sides as well as serve warm.

2. American pancakes
Over the past few years, we’ve noticed a growing interest in American-style pancakes, and it’s not hard to see why. A thick, fluffier alternative the European pancake, these beauties are easily stackable and can be loaded with all the toppings imaginable.

3. American blueberry pancakes
One of our oldest recipes, this fruity variation of American pancakes makes a delicious dessert or brunch. Incorporating blueberries into the mixture gives these pancakes delicious little fresh pockets of flavour that burst when you bite into them. Teamed with maple syrup, these American blueberry pancakes are a sweet sensation.
4. Chocolate-stuffed pancakes with caramelised banana
Looking for an all-out indulgent brunch recipe? These sweet and sticky American pancakes come with a hidden chocolate centre and are oozing with maple syrup. Golden caramelised bananas are stacked between the pancakes, and it’s finished with a scattering of crunchy hazelnuts. These chocolate-filled pancakes have long been a favourite with our audience and well worth the effort.
